The postcode N21 2PB is located in Enfield, in the county of Outer London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. N21 2PB is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

N21 2PB is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of N21 2PB as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.

The closest road name to N21 2PB is River Bank which is centered 85 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Green Dragon Lane and is 30 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 2.53 km away at Southgate Underground Station The closest railway station is Winchmore Hill Rail Station, 714 m away.

The closest primary school to N21 2PB (for ages 11 and under) is St Paul's CofE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on February 23, 2012.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Winchmore School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 22, 2016 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of N21 2PB is The Owl Ltd and is 8.01 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on January 7,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Ramen and is 8.4 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on March 11,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 81.5 Mbps and an average upload speed of 7.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 94.7%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 94.7%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 5.3%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.5 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for N21 2PB is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Enfield is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
